Recent shifts in urban commuting reflect broader trends across U.S. cities. Rising taxi fares, long wait times, and limited public transit coverage increasingly push travelers toward flexible, self-driven alternatives. Chicago stands at the crossroads: a vibrant cultural hub with deep neighborhoods and world-class attractions, yet still constrained by taxi systems built for short trips—not full-day journeys or group travel. Renting a van bypasses these bottlenecks, letting users travel on their own terms—whether driving family road trips, launching weekend getaways, or transporting gear and crew for creative ventures. Digital platforms now make this simpler than ever, connecting users instantly to vetted van rental services across the city.
